Fresh off his victory over Raymond Ford, WBC Champion O’Shaquie Foster joins Brian Custer on The Last Stand for one of his most revealing interviews yet.
🏆 O’Shaquie breaks down his performance against Raymond Ford, discusses the adjustments he made, and explains why he believes he showed once again that he belongs among boxing’s elite.
🔥 Foster addresses his history with Shakur Stevenson, reacts to Shakur previously calling him one of the best fighters in boxing, discusses their sparring sessions, reveals where the tension began, and talks about the possibility of a future showdown.
👀 O’Shaquie also discusses potential fights with Gervonta “Tank” Davis, Lamont Roach, and Emanuel Navarrete while revealing which matchups he hopes to secure next.
🥊 Plus, Foster gives his thoughts on Devin Haney vs Keyshawn Davis, Xander Zayas vs Jaron “Boots” Ennis, and Errol Spence Jr. vs Tim Tszyu.
💯 O’Shaquie opens up about his life story, overcoming adversity, Houston’s boxing culture, and his desire to prove he’s not just the best fighter at 130 pounds—but one of the best fighters in the entire sport.

Listen, you come off with a contentious fight with a challenger and a decisive victory over Raymond Ford at home. What does that victory of that magnitude say about Oshaki Foster?
SPEAKER_00It just says I'm one of the best fighters in the world, if not the best fighter in the world in my eyes. I'm going to keep uh knocking them down and you know keep doing what I do.
SPEAKER_01I I want to know at what point in the fight did you say to yourself, oh, I got this? Because I'm gonna, I'm gonna gather, for me, it was at the face off when he pushed you, and he was so heated, and I saw you just so calm, and it was like you were smiling, like, yeah, I don't know why you're so much in your feelings. But at that point, I was like, see, that's experience right there. He's so cool, and this other guy is so heated. But when in the fight did you know you had it?
SPEAKER_00In the fight, um, I so I knew his tendencies and what he wanted to do before the fight. It's just um around like the fourth round, I picked up his the time and how I wanted to with you know him leaping and his uh speed. Um, so that was my big adjustment that I wanted to make early was uh take away, you get the gauge of how how fast he is and the distance. And once I felt that, it was like, all right, now it's time for me to work.
SPEAKER_01Yeah, yeah. And and and and I loved how you closed the fight because you you you you bloodied him up in the 11th, and then in the 12th round, you I mean you just stepped on the gas. It just seems like, especially in the second half of the fight, what was the what was the main thing that impressed you when you looked at back at the tape, said, all right, that's what I'm talking about.
SPEAKER_00I would say the way I put my combinations together. Um I was working on that a lot during this camp and just wanting to put punches on top of punches. And I feel like I showed a little bit of that. Actually, I feel like I showed a lot of that um in the second half of the fight, just putting four or five punch combinations on top of each other and just let really just let my hands go. Um, that's kind of been a knock on my on my performances in the past, is throwing too many one-punch shots and stuff like that. So I just wanted to pick it up and you know, I just want to keep getting better. So each fight, you know, I'm I'm trying to pull out something different.
SPEAKER_01I've said this all the time, and I even think the last time we spoke, I asked you this question. I said, why do folks keep underestimating Oshocki Foster? Do you do you think you finally answered those questions after this performance?
SPEAKER_00Um I definitely think I answered a lot of them questions. This is my my second elite guy in a row that I that I shut out and made, you know, uh show that he wasn't on my level. But uh as I get, I'm starting to notice the fans, they always move the goalposts. So now they're saying that uh, you know, if he wouldn't have gassed out or whatever, but they don't understand that I was working the body, I kept stabbing the body, I did a lot of underrated body work in that fight to make him gas out. Then I kept I kept a mental pressure on him. It was a lot of things in that fight that made him gas out and not just conditioning. Because he was in he was in dog shape, you can tell. It's just he couldn't keep up with the pace, he couldn't keep up with, you know, certain things I was doing. And I feel like that's what made him get tired. And but the fans is you know, they they they always move the goalposts. Uh, but I'm willing to keep proving myself. It is what it is.
